Curriculum: The BSc (Hons) Biology (Placement) curriculum at the University of Gloucestershire is designed to provide a broad and deep understanding of biological principles. Core modules typically cover fundamental areas such as Diversity and Evolution, Fundamentals of Ecology, Biochemistry, and Animal Physiology. Students also develop crucial research skills through modules like "Methods in Biology" and "Field Research Training," which often include 1 field trips in the UK and potentially overseas to diverse ecosystems in locations like South Africa, Borneo, or Switzerland. In the second year, the curriculum may include modules such as Animal Behaviour, Microbiology, and Research: Skills & Proposal: Biology. The third year is dedicated to the Internship/Professional Experience/Field Placement, providing invaluable real-world experience. In the final year, students undertake a significant independent research project, the "Biology Dissertation," allowing for in-depth exploration of a chosen topic. Optional modules in the later years allow for further specialization in areas such as Biogeography, Cellular Pathology, Marine Ecology, and Biotechnology.

Undergraduate Entry Requirements

Academic Qualifications: Applicants should have successfully completed their secondary education with a minimum overall score of 65% or equivalent in their respective country's grading system.

English language proficiency:

  • IELTS: A minimum overall score of 6.0 or 6.5 with no individual component below 5.5.
  • TOEFL: A minimum overall score of 80.
  • PTE Academic: A minimum overall score of 64.
  • Some programs may have specific subject prerequisites or additional requirements.

International Scholarships: The University of Gloucestershire offers International Scholarships for students coming from various countries across the globe. These scholarships typically range from £1,000 to £3,000 per year, based on academic achievement and the chosen course of study. The scholarship is automatically awarded to eligible students upon acceptance of their offer to study at the university. These awards are designed to make studying in the UK more affordable and are available for both undergraduate and postgraduate international students.

Excellence Scholarships: For international students who demonstrate outstanding academic performance, the University of Gloucestershire offers Excellence Scholarships. These scholarships are awarded to students who have achieved exceptional academic results in their previous studies. The Excellence Scholarship can be worth up to £3,000 and is designed to recognize and support high-achieving students who show great potential in their chosen field of study.
